My husband and I just built a chicken coop for the one hen that we have it is 2x4 in size and 2 feet above ground. How do I get her to go in there ?i put her in there and she flew out and went back in the tree where she has been sleeping. Any ideas?
Thanks
 
You'll probably have to put her in there and close her in for a few days if she's used to roosting outside. Does she have any flockmates? Chickens are social and don't usually do well without others. Is there a run attached to the coop? That size seems a little on the small size to me. If you had a run attached to the coop, she could go in and out and you wouldn't have to worry about her flying off to her tree, but she could still get sunshine, fresh air, and find bugs and things to munch on.
 
Chickens are flock animals and don't like to be alone. She will be much happier with chicken friends. Sleeping in trees is the best way to get eaten by owls or other predators. Birds do not like to move in the dark so they are sitting ducks. It's also a great time for you to catch her and put her on the roost in your coop at and close the door. If you leave her in the coop for a couple of days (with food and water), she should imprint on that as her home.
